Bengaluru, Dec 1 Chandni Naik, a local BJP leader in Karnataka, who was attacked by BJP MLA Siddu Savadi and his supporters on November 9 has allegedly suffered a miscarriage following the heckling. Her husband Nagesh Naik, another BJP leader from Mahalingpur in Bagalkot district, has made the charges against the MLA. Chandni Naik is a member of the Mahalingpur Town Municipal Council (TMC). India Today TV had earlier reported how the MLA along with his supporters had pushed her to stop her from voting in the elections to the posts of president and vice-president. The video of the MLA attacking the councillor went viral on social media. The husband has now decided to drag the BJP MLA to court. Chandni Naik said, “The MLA did rowdyism and pulled me. Can the MLA do this? How can women be in politics? PM says beti bachao beti padhao. So, is this right?” MLA Savadi has debunked the allegations against him and said that it is a bogus claim by the woman. “I am getting hospital reports that she got tubectomy done 6 years ago. In a day I will release.
